The Collaborative Team Approach

A Process With Clearly Defined Roles

At the heart of the collaborative law process is a team of people working together to resolve your family's disputes and concerns. Some members of this team are present in every case, while others are optional.

Below is some information about the role each participant plays:

  • The parties: These may be a married couple going through divorce, unmarried or divorced parents with a dispute about child custody modification, or anyone else with a family law issue. Their role is to seek a good-faith resolution of their concerns, one that works for both of them. Each is represented by a lawyer, and they must agree before bringing in any other professionals.
  • The attorneys: Each attorney represents one client. Both attorneys should be trained in collaborative family law and committed to the process. They must operate in an atmosphere of transparency.   • A financial professional: A CPA or financial planner can gather information about each party's finances and suggest the most mutually advantageous ways of making property division, child support, and spousal support arrangements.
  • A mental health professional: A psychologist or social worker can help you create a parenting plan for your children and act as a coach to help everyone emotionally.
  • The judge: Every divorce must be approved by a judge. However, in Texas, collaborative family law is explicitly recognized as a valid alternative to litigation, and the judge will normally respect the collaborative decision of the parties, unless it contradicts state law.
